Planning Through the Decades: Money Habits for Every Stage of Life

Nick J. Russell, CRPC® & Becky Wagoner Episode 30

Nick Russell and Becky Wagoner break down what retirement planning really looks like at each stage of life. From the first savings habits in your 30s, to protecting your income and family in your 40s, to running “stress tests” in your 50s to see if you are truly on track, this episode is packed with practical insights and relatable stories. 

Nick shares how even $300 a month in your 30s can grow into $1 million, why time in the market matters more than timing, and how reviewing insurance and running projections can prevent costly mistakes later on. Becky adds real-life perspective, including what Fidelity suggests you should have saved by each decade.
